Isodicentric X chromosome and mosaicism: report on two cases of 45,X/46,X,idic(Xq)/47,X,idic(Xq),idic(Xq) and review of the literature

Am J Med Genet. 1993 Sep 1;47(3):357-9. doi: 10.1002/ajmg.1320470312.

Abstract

We present 2 instances of Ullrich-Turner syndrome with mosaicism 45,X/46,X,idic(Xq)/47, X,idic(Xq),idic(Xq) and X-isochromosomes with 2 C-bands. The mosaicism with the 3 cell lines points to the presence of the isodicentric chromosome in the zygote and a subsequent nondisjunction event.
